On the solvability and regularity of comparison problems for text fragments. (Russian ;English)
Zh. Vychisl. Mat. Mat. Fiz. 46, No. 4, 763-768 (2006); translation in Comput. Math. Math. Phys. 46, No. 4, 726-731 (2006).
Summary: Within the framework of the algebraic approach to the synthesis of correct algorithms, a class of problems is studied in which the elements of the initial-information space are numerical descriptions of pairs of text fragments. Solution algorithms use these descriptions to classify the original pairs of fragments according to the degree of their similarity or dissimilarity (in a certain sense). Solvability and regularity criteria for such problems are derived. The special case of constructing monotone solutions to the problems is discussed. Criteria for the monotone solvability and monotone regularity of the problems are proved.
